Aprilaire Model 550 doesn't work
Hi - my first post here and need some help...seems like everyone is uber helpful here!
Here's the situation - just moved into a resale home, and I think the humidifier Aprilaire model 550 is 10 years old...it isn't working and the house is dry. My hardwood floors now have gaps between them - roughly around 30% humidity according to my $2 hygrometer.
Here's what I know:
- Water valve is open, line to solenoid is cold
- Solenoid seems like it is closed (pretty sure it is)
- Humidstat clicks when I turn it
- Humidstat is connected to furnace panel
- Tried to reset the humidstat but actually there is no reset function. This is what it looks like
- I don't think anything is plugged either...doesn't even drip
I tested it while the blower and heat is on, so that it is activated. Don't know if the solenoid is broken...are these my next steps?
1. Bypass humidstat wiring and plug directly to solenoid to see if it opens. If it does open, replace humidstat?
2. Is it possible to manually open the solenoid? to see if water runs thru the line?
